Marriage isn't mostly for love. It's mostly a business contract between two families. Usually, there is a bride price, meaning the groom and the family are actually buying the woman because the daughter's family will scream "you're taking her away. What is our compensation for it?" If you don't pay it, the marriage is off and you can and will get sued for whatever the bride's family determines is the offense (usually it's loss of face).

One thing Chinese men are doing is buying their wives from vietnam (if they aren't wealthy) or from Ukraine and Russia (if they are because a blond, blue eyed white wife is LOADS of mian zi). then they are given a "spouse visa," but you can't work legally on one of those (I know. I have one because China changed work visa law requirements during COVID19 and I was denied a new work visa residence permit), so the foreign spouse becomes pretty much a slave to the chinese spouse. . .one word from the Chinese spouse and the marriage ends, the foreigner is arrested and fined out the ying-yang, then deported with a ten year black list. Oh, and the deportation is at the cost of the foreigner too.
